Overview:

The Production designer is responsible for ensuring brand supplied and internally created artwork meets guidelines, matches product placement or promotional merchandising, and is press-ready. This role is also responsible for building out multiple versions of each graphic, proofing out to merchants and/or brand partners and applying codes for store set and inventory ordering. Production Designers must embody a mix of creative and technical know-how to provide quality, efficient production of in-store promotional signage and inline graphics. The Production Designer will partner with internal merchandising analysts and merchants, various print vendors and brand partners to ensure the correct signage and graphics are printed for the appropriate store set week. 
 
Main Responsibilities: 

  • Accept direction from In-Store Design Production Manager and carry out department's production processes and objectives.
  • Show meticulous attention to detail when reviewing artwork to ensure it meets our standards; checks layout specs, including bleed, trim, resolutions, color etc.
  • Make various formats or versions of supplied artwork to route for approvals. 
  • Follow naming conventions and server structure.
  • Inspect work to ensure quality and accuracy. 
  • Preflight and package final press-ready files for release to printers.
  • Create and/or work within production templates.
  • Maintain graphic libraries for each brand, as needed.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ional partners, external vendors and/or printer vendors to problem solve and meet established in-store dates.
